In the constantly evolving landscape of NFTs, few projects have managed to capture the zeitgeist as effectively as Deadfellaz. With their playful yet eerie zombie-themed avatars, the collection first launched on the Ethereum blockchain in August 2021 and took the market by storm during the NFT boom later that year. Now, Deadfellaz is on the brink of introducing a new mini-iteration affectionately dubbed “smol.” The announcement, made by Psych, the director at DFZ Labs, sent ripples of excitement through the community, sparking speculation about the potential features and implications of this new arrival.

While details remain vague, speculation suggests that “smol” may involve customizable avatar layers. This would allow holders to modify their Deadfellaz characters, running parallel to the ambition of projects like Doodles 2. The prospect of tailoring avatars heightens the stakes, as it can serve as a valid bridge between the static world of NFTs and the dynamic needs of gamers and collectors alike.

The Integration of Technology with Ownership: Coldlink and Beyond

Deadfellaz has already begun diversifying its ecosystem with innovative tools such as Coldlink—an asset ownership verification mechanism designed to unify hot wallets and social media handles securely. This initiative has gained traction as it speaks to a significant concern among NFT collectors: security and authenticity. In an industry rife with scams and fraudulent activities, tools that enhance ownership verification are not just welcome but essential.

By integrating this technology, Deadfellaz is taking the lead in establishing a more secure environment for collectors and gamers. Furthermore, with the upcoming releases of both the Death Touch trading card game and Wallhugger—a PvP horror game on Roblox—the inclusion of Coldlink represents a major strategic pivot. It provides foundational support that could allow for seamless interactions with other games, amplifying the utility of NFTs beyond just digital art or collectibles.

Collaborations That Matter: Why Partnerships Are More Than Just Marketing

The success of any NFT project is often tied closely to strategic partnerships, and Deadfellaz has not shied away from forging meaningful collaborations. Having teamed up with recognizable brands like Wrangler and Dim Mak, Deadfellaz is seamlessly merging digital and physical realms. This also begs the question: are we witnessing the birth of a new cultural paradigm where NFTs could serve as vehicles for real-world experiences?

The partnerships signify contextually rich narratives that can deepen brand engagement beyond mere speculation or hype. They hold the potential to redefine values attached to digital assets, as they layer community engagement over simple ownership. Achieving a balance of artistic integrity and commercial viability will be a tall order, but it’s a venture that may separate the leaders from the followers in a crowded market.
